Reserve Sump Pump Solutions: A Thorough Guide
Protecting your lower level from water damage is critical , and while a primary submersible pump is a reliable start, a reserve system can offer extra protection against power outages . These backup pumps come in multiple designs, including electricity-free models, water-driven alternatives, and electricity-supplied setups. Choosing the appropriate reserve system depends on your unique situation , your cost considerations, and the likelihood of flooding in your area . Properly setting up and servicing both your primary and backup systems is important for long-term safety against costly basement flooding .

Essential Sump Pump Battery Backup Maintenance Tips
Protecting your basement from flooding requires more than just a working sump pump; a reliable battery backup is crucial when power outages strike. Keeping your backup system functions correctly demands periodic care . Here's how to ensure it prepared for when you need it most:
- Check the battery's voltage level frequently – ideally, monthly. A diminished charge indicates a potential concern.
- Wipe any corrosion from the battery terminals. This hinders function . Use a battery brush and a vinegar solution.
- Test the backup system sometimes under a mock power outage. This validates its ability to kick in.
- Substitute the battery approximately 3-5 years, or earlier if it displays signs of degradation . Battery longevity varies.
- Properly position the battery to avoid vibration, which can damage the connections.
